Understanding the Polar H10 Heart Rate Monitor

The Polar H10 is a chest strap heart rate monitor known for its accuracy and reliability. Unlike wrist-based monitors, chest straps measure the electrical signals of your heart directly, providing precise data. The H10 connects seamlessly with various fitness apps and devices, making it a versatile choice for runners.

Key Features of the Polar H10

  • High Accuracy: Provides precise heart rate data essential for effective training.
  • Comfortable Fit: Designed to stay snug without causing discomfort during runs.
  • Compatibility: Works with popular apps like Polar Beat, Strava, and MyFitnessPal.
  • Long Battery Life: Up to 400 hours of use on a single charge.
  • Water Resistance: Suitable for swimming and wet conditions.

How the H10 Can Help You Break Running Records

Accurate heart rate data is crucial for optimizing training intensity. The Polar H10 allows runners to monitor their effort in real-time, ensuring they stay within their target zones. This precision helps prevent overtraining and undertraining, both of which can hinder progress.

Training Optimization

By maintaining the right intensity, runners can improve their aerobic capacity, speed, and endurance. The H10’s detailed metrics enable tailored workouts that push boundaries safely and effectively.

Data Analysis and Progress Tracking

The device syncs with various apps, allowing runners to analyze their performance over time. Tracking improvements helps identify patterns, set realistic goals, and stay motivated to beat personal bests.

Limitations and Considerations

While the Polar H10 offers precise data, it is only one part of a comprehensive training plan. Factors such as nutrition, rest, and mental preparation are equally important. Additionally, some runners may prefer wrist-based monitors for convenience, despite their lower accuracy.

Cost and Accessibility

The Polar H10 is priced higher than basic fitness trackers, but its accuracy justifies the investment for serious runners. Compatibility with multiple devices makes it accessible to a broad audience.
